[Pidgin] #16238: Don't let the "connecting" state block unread message notifications from the status icon

Pidgin trac at pidgin.im
Tue May 20 22:30:01 EDT 2014


#16238: Don't let the "connecting" state block unread message notifications from
the status icon
---------------------+--------------------------
 Reporter:  cyisfor  |      Owner:
     Type:  patch    |     Status:  new
Milestone:           |  Component:  pidgin (gtk)
  Version:  3.0.0hg  |   Keywords:
---------------------+--------------------------
 When I get new unread messages, I could care less whether pidgin is in the
 process of connecting to one server or another. The "connecting" state of
 the status icon should not take priority over the "pending" state because
 nobody cares about knowing when they're connecting to a server, and
 everybody cares about knowing when they have pending messages. That is to
 say, the little connecty-plugs "connection in progress" icon in the system
 tray should never appear while there are pending unread messages.

 This has been bothering me for a while. Finally decided to fix it after
 someone tried to get in touch with me for the better part of an hour
 yesterday and I didn't even see it because a flaky server pidgin was
 continually "connecting" to hid the pending status.

 I think this fixes the problem. I tested it:
 1) send message from test account leaving it in background so unread
 2) disconnect/reconnect to some slow server
 3) status icon continues to blink even while connecting

 If there's something I've missed let me know.

-- 
Ticket URL: <https://developer.pidgin.im/ticket/16238>
Pidgin <https://pidgin.im>
Pidgin


More information about the Tracker mailing list